# Features
## Introduction
<i class="fa fa-file-text"></i> **CodiMD** is a real-time, multi-platform collaborative markdown note editor.
This means that you can write notes with other people on your **desktop**, **tablet** or even on the **phone**.
You can sign-in via multiple auth providers like **Facebook**, **Twitter**, **GitHub** and many more on the [_homepage_](/).

## Workspace
### Modes
#### Desktop & Tablet
<i class="fa fa-eye fa-fw"></i> View: See only the result.
<i class="fa fa-columns fa-fw"></i> Both: See editor and result at the same time.
<i class="fa fa-pencil fa-fw"></i> Edit: See only the editor.
#### Mobile
<i class="fa fa-eye fa-fw"></i> View: See only the result.
<i class="fa fa-pencil fa-fw"></i> Edit: See only the editor.
### Night Mode
When you are tired of a white screen and like a night mode, click on the little moon <i class="fa fa-moon-o"></i> and turn on the night view of CodiMD.
The editor view, which is in night mode by default, can also be toggled between night and day view using the the little sun<i class="fa fa-sun-o fa-fw"></i>.
### Image Upload
You can upload an image simply by clicking on the upload button <i class="fa fa-upload"></i>.
Alternatively, you can **drag-n-drop** an image into the editor. Even **pasting** images is possible!
This will automatically upload the image to **[imgur](http://imgur.com)**, **[Amazon S3](https://aws.amazon.com/s3/)**, **[Minio](https://minio.io)** or the **local filesystem** (depending on the instance's configuration), nothing to worry about. :tada:
![imgur](https://i.imgur.com/9cgQVqD.png)
### Share Notes
If you want to share an **editable** note, just copy the URL.
If you want to share a **read-only** note, simply press the publish button <i class="fa fa-share-square-o"></i> and copy the URL.
### Save a Note
Currently, you can save to **Dropbox** <i class="fa fa-dropbox"></i> (depending on the instance's configuration) or save a Markdown <i class="fa fa-file-text"></i>, HTML or raw HTML <i class="fa fa-file-code-o"></i> file locally.
### Import Notes
Similarly to the _save_ feature, you can also import a Markdown file from **Dropbox** <i class="fa fa-dropbox"></i> (depending on the instance's configuration), or import content from your **clipboard** <i class="fa fa-clipboard"></i>, which can parse some HTML. :smiley:
### Permissions
It is possible to change the access permission of a note through the little button on the top right of the view.
There are four possible options:
| |Owner read/write|Signed-in read|Signed-in write|Guest read|Guest write|
|:-----------------------------|:--------------:|:------------:|:-------------:|:--------:|:---------:|
|<span class="text-nowrap"><i class="fa fa-leaf fa-fw"></i> **Freely**</span>|✔|✔|✔|✔|✔|
|<span class="text-nowrap"><i class="fa fa-pencil fa-fw"></i> **Editable**</span>|✔|✔|✔|✔|✖|
|<span class="text-nowrap"><i class="fa fa-id-card fa-fw"></i> **Limited**</span>|✔|✔|✔|✖|✖|
|<span class="text-nowrap"><i class="fa fa-lock fa-fw"></i> **Locked**</span>|✔|✔|✖|✔|✖|
|<span class="text-nowrap"><i class="fa fa-umbrella fa-fw"></i> **Protected**</span>|✔|✔|✖|✖|✖|
|<span class="text-nowrap"><i class="fa fa-hand-stop-o fa-fw"></i> **Private**</span>|✔|✖|✖|✖|✖|
**Only the owner of the note can change the note's permissions.**
### Embed a Note
Notes can be embedded as follows:
```xml
<iframe width="100%" height="500" src="https://demo.codimd.io/features" frameborder="0"></iframe>
```

## View
### Autogenerated Table of Contents
You can look at the bottom right section of the view area, there is a _ToC_ button <i class="fa fa-bars"></i>.
Pressing that button will show you a current _Table of Contents_, and will highlight which section you're at.
ToCs support up to **three header levels**.
### Permalink
Every header will automatically add a permalink on the right side.
You can hover and click <i class="fa fa-chain"></i> to anchor on it.
## Edit
### Editor Modes
You can look in the bottom right section of the editor area, there you'll find a button with `SUBLIME` on it.
When you click it, you can select 3 editor modes, which will also define your shortcut keys:
- [Sublime](https://codemirror.net/demo/sublime.html) (default)
- [Emacs](https://codemirror.net/demo/emacs.html)
- [Vim](https://codemirror.net/demo/vim.html)
### Auto-Complete
This editor provides full auto-complete hints in markdown.
- Emojis: type `:` to show hints.
- Code blocks: type ` ``` `, followed by another character to show syntax highlighting suggestions.
- Headers: type `#` to show hint.
- Referrals: type `[]` to show hint.
- Externals: type `{}` to show hint.
- Images: type `!` to show hint.
### Title
The first **level 1 heading** (e.g. `# Title`) will be used as the note title.
### Tags
Using tags as follows, the specified tags will show in your **history**.
###### tags: `features` `cool` `updated`
### [YAML Metadata](./yaml-metadata)
You can provide advanced note information to set the browser behavior (visit above link for details):
- robots: set web robots meta
- lang: set browser language
- dir: set text direction
- breaks: set to use line breaks
- GA: set to use Google Analytics
- disqus: set to use Disqus
- slideOptions: setup slide mode options
### Table of Contents
Use the syntax `[TOC]` to embed a table of contents into your note.

### Code Block
We support many programming languages, use the auto complete function to see the entire list.

If you want **line numbers**, type `=` after specifying the code block languagues.
Also, you can specify the start line number.
Like below, the line number starts from 101:
```javascript=101
var s = "JavaScript syntax highlighting";
alert(s);
function $initHighlight(block, cls) {
try {
if (cls.search(/\bno\-highlight\b/) != -1)
return process(block, true, 0x0F) +
' class=""';
} catch (e) {
/* handle exception */
}
for (var i = 0 / 2; i < classes.length; i++) {
if (checkCondition(classes[i]) === undefined)
return /\d+[\s/]/g;
}
}
```
Or you might want to continue the previous code block's line number, use `=+`:
```javascript=+
var s = "JavaScript syntax highlighting";
alert(s);
```
